Office, shop or coworking: which space for your business?
- The classic office: an open floor or partitioned space in an office building, ideal for service companies, firms and independent professionals who receive clients.
- The commercial unit: a ground floor with a window display, designed for retail, catering or showrooms, where footfall drives turnover.
- Coworking and flexible offices: desks or private offices rented by the month, booming in Tunis, perfect for freelancers and small teams who want a business address without a heavy commitment.
Where to rent an office or a shop in Tunisia?
Charguia 1 and 2: pragmatism near the airport
The Charguia zones remain a safe bet for companies combining offices, workshops and logistics. Rents there are gentler than at the Lac, with direct access to the airport and the main roads of Greater Tunis.
Centre Urbain Nord and Berges du Lac: image and services
The Centre Urbain Nord lines up recent office buildings highly prized by service companies. Berges du Lac 1 and 2 offer the most prestigious address in the country, at the cost of some of the highest rents in Tunis.
El Ghazala technopole and the technology parks
For IT companies and development centres, the El Ghazala technopole in Ariana gathers telecom operators, software publishers and startups in an ecosystem built for innovation. The technology parks of Sousse and Sfax play the same role in the regions, with attractive set-up costs.
How to choose your premises: the criteria that count
Before signing a lease, put every offer under the microscope:
- Location: visibility and footfall for a shop, accessibility and parking for an office.
- Floor space and layout: open space or partitioned offices, storeroom and window display for a shop, room to grow.
- Condition and equipment: air conditioning, fibre optics, a lift, electrical compliance.
- Rent and charges: rent per square metre compared with the neighbourhood, service charges, security, local taxes.
- The contract: length of the lease, rent review conditions, authorisation for the business carried out and exit clause.
